A militia-based government program seeks to take over the world using Aaron's Rod, led by the anti-Christ reincarnated. The discovery of the Ark of the Covenant and the Four Horsemen of the Apocalypse help him get that much closer. Nephilim are discovered amongst mankind and are forced into compounds, where their mental and emotional strength is tested. And caught in the fray are two sisters, Piper and Wren, who are apart of the Divine Bloodline.

It was a great book, there was once or twice that the descriptions felt a little overly technical that would disrupt the flow of the story or make you come to a complete halt to figure out what it was talking about. If reading it would not have felt so disruptive but while listening it made it harder to stop and jump back in. I love the story, a little bit of a slow burn at the beginning but you don’t even know it has you hooked until you’re half way through and don’t wanna stop listening until it’s done.
